Group 1 - Since the 18th National Congress, China has become the fastest and largest country in the world for increasing greenery, with over 1 billion acres of afforestation and a forest coverage rate exceeding 25% [2][4] - The natural forest restoration began in 2014 with a halt on commercial logging in key state-owned forest areas, leading to significant recovery of natural forests [2][3] - The forest stock volume has surpassed 20 billion cubic meters, contributing approximately one-fourth of the world's new forest area [2] Group 2 - In regions with harsh natural conditions, such as Inner Mongolia, significant ecological improvements have been observed, with dust storms decreasing from 11 times to 1 time per year [3] - New vegetation has emerged in urban parks and coastal areas, enhancing local biodiversity and community engagement, with around 20,000 visitors daily in certain green spaces [5] - The ongoing greening efforts are seen as a crucial step towards building an ecological safety barrier for sustainable development in China [5]
